Transaction 76ab13569d5d825cdfb3db27d4c77d9a98b7a8d53e5bcdfea97dac8f7718477e

block
3866807712e9e29ae2349775629deb8d0850c03c8937b7c03af862fd022d2293

1 Input

2 Outputs